Hadith 26529

حَدَّثَنَا يَزِيدُ ، قَالَ : حَدَّثَنَا حَمَّادُ بْنُ سَلَمَةَ ، عَنْ ثَابِتٍ الْبُنَانِيِّ ، قَالَ : حَدَّثَنِي ابْنُ عُمَرَ بْنِ أَبِي سَلَمَةَ ، عَنْ أَبِيهِ ، عَنْ أُمِّ سَلَمَةَ , أَنَّ رَسُولَ اللَّهِ صَلَّى اللَّه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 خَطَبَ أُمَّ سَلَمَةَ ، فَقَالَتْ : يَا رَسُولَ اللَّهِ ، إِنَّهُ لَيْسَ أَحَدٌ مِنْ أَوْلِيَائِي تَعْنِي شَاهِدًا ، فَقَالَ : " إِنَّهُ لَيْسَ أَحَدٌ مِنْ أَوْلِيَائِكِ شَاهِدٌ وَلَا غَائِبٌ يَكْرَهُ ذَلِكَ " , فَقَالَتْ : يَا عُمَرُ زَوِّجْ النَّبِيَّ صَلَّى اللَّه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 ، فَتَزَوَّجَهَا النَّبِيُّ صَلَّى اللَّه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 ، فَقَالَ لَهَا رَسُولُ اللَّهِ صَلَّى اللَّه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 : " أَمَا إِنِّي لَا أَنْقُصُكِ مِمَّا أَعْطَيْتُ أَخَوَاتِكِ رَحْيَيْنِ ، وَجَرَّةً ، وَمِرْفَقَةً مِنْ أَدَمٍ ، حَشْوُهَا لِيفٌ " . فَكَانَ رَسُولُ اللَّهِ صَلَّى اللَّه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 يَأْتِيهَا لِيَدْخُلَ بِهَا ، فَإِذَا رَأَتْهُ ، أَخَذَتْ زَيْنَبَ ابْنَتَهَا ، فَجَعَلَتْهَا فِي حِجْرِهَا ، فَيَنْصَرِفُ رَسُولُ اللَّهِ صَلَّى اللَّه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 ، فَعَلِمَ ذَلِكَ عَمَّارُ بْنُ يَاسِرٍ ، وَكَانَ أَخَاهَا مِنَ الرَّضَاعَةِ ، فَأَتَاهَا ، فَقَالَ : أَيْنَ هَذِهِ الْمَشْقُوحَةُ الْمَقْبُوحَةُ الَّتِي قَدْ آذَيْتِ بِهَا رَسُولَ اللَّهِ صَلَّى اللَّه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 ؟ فَأَخَذَهَا ، فَذَهَبَ بِهَا ، فَجَاءَ رَسُولُ اللَّهِ صَلَّى اللَّه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 ، فَدَخَلَ عَلَيْهَا ، فَجَعَلَ يَضْرِبُ بِبَصَرِهِ فِي نَوَاحِي الْبَيْتِ ، فَقَالَ : مَا فَعَلَتْ زَنَابُ ؟ فَقَالَتْ : جَاءَ عَمَّارٌ ، فَأَخَذَهَا ، فَذَهَبَ بِهَا ، فَدَخَلَ بِهَا رَسُولُ اللَّهِ صَلَّى اللَّه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 ، وَقَالَ لَهَا : " إِنْ شِئْتِ سَبَّعْتُ لَكِ ، سَبَّعْتُ وَإِنْ سَبَّعْتُ لَكِ سَبَّعْتُ لِنِسَائِي " .
It is narrated from Hazrat Umm Salamah (may Allah be pleased with her) that the Prophet (peace and blessings be upon him) sent her a marriage proposal. She said, "O Messenger of Allah, none of my guardians are present here." The Prophet (peace and blessings be upon him) said, "None of your guardians, whether absent or present, will dislike this." She then said to her son, Umar bin Abi Salamah, "You arrange my marriage with the Prophet (peace and blessings be upon him)." So he gave Hazrat Umm Salamah in marriage to the Prophet (peace and blessings be upon him). Then the Prophet (peace and blessings be upon him) said to her, "Whatever I have given to your sisters (my wives), I will not give you less than that: two millstones, a water-skin, and a leather pillow stuffed with palm fiber." After this, whenever the Prophet (peace and blessings be upon him) would come to her for privacy, as soon as she saw him, she would take her daughter Zainab and seat her in her lap, and eventually the Prophet (peace and blessings be upon him) would leave in the same way. When Hazrat Ammar bin Yasir, who was Hazrat Umm Salamah's foster brother, learned of this, he came to Hazrat Umm Salamah and said, "Where is that dirty girl through whom you have been causing the Prophet (peace and blessings be upon him) distress?" and he took her away with him. This time, when the Prophet (peace and blessings be upon him) came and entered the house, he looked around in all four corners of the room and then asked about the girl, "Where is Zanab (Zainab)?" She replied, "Hazrat Ammar came and took her with him." Then the Prophet (peace and blessings be upon him) had privacy with her and said, "If you wish, I will spend seven days with you, but then I will also spend seven days with each of my other wives."
Hadith Reference مسند احمد / مسند النساء / 26529
Hadith Grading حکم دارالسلام: قوله: "ان شئت سبعت لك، وان سبعت لك سبعت لنسائي" صحيح، وهذا اسناد ضعيف لجهالة ابن عمر بن ابي سلمة
